Ms. Marci R. Rosenberg

Marci R. Rosenberg PC


Marci Rosenberg is a native of Louisville, Kentucky.  Ms. Rosenberg graduated from Emory University in 1990 with a Bachelor of Arts degree in Sociology and Philosophy.  She is a 1993 Emory Law School graduate and has been representing plaintiffs in civil litigation matters throughout the State of Georgia since that time.  She opened her own practice in December of 1995 devoted to representing victims in workers’ compensation, trucking, and personal injury cases.  She is former President and current member of the Board of Directors of the Workers’ Compensation Claimants’ Lawyers section of GTLA.  She is also a current member of the Board of Directors and is former Educational Director of the Georgia Legal Foundation (formerly the Amicus Curiae Committee of the WCCL).  Ms. Rosenberg is a Fellow of the College of Workers Compensation Lawyers.  She has also served as a guest lecturer on workers' compensation and practice related topics at Emory University's School of Law.
